생물 조직 탈수기 시장 규모는 2025년에 5억 9,010만 달러로 평가되었으며, 2026년부터 2033년까지 CAGR 6.8%로 확대될 것으로 전망됩니다.

생물 조직 탈수기는 조직학 및 병리학 연구실에서 현미경 검사를 위한 조직 표본을 준비하기 위해 사용되는 실험 기기입니다. 이 장치는 농도를 단계적으로 높인 일련의 알코올 용액을 사용하여 조직 표본에서 수분을 서서히 제거하는 방식으로 작동합니다. 이 필수적인 전처리 공정을 통해 효율적인 투명화 및 파라핀 침지가 가능해지며, 조직의 완전성을 유지하고 표본의 품질을 향상시킴으로써 정확한 진단 평가 및 연구 분석을 촉진합니다.

Biological Tissue Dehydrator Market size was valued at USD 590.1 Million in 2025, expanding to a CAGR of 6.8% from 2026 to 2033.

A biological tissue dehydrator is a laboratory instrument used in histology and pathology laboratories to prepare tissue samples for microscopic examination. It works by gradually removing water from tissue specimens with a series of alcohol solutions of increasing concentration. This essential preliminary step allows for efficient clearing and paraffin infiltration, which aids in preserving tissue integrity and enhancing sample quality, thereby facilitating precise diagnostic evaluation and research analysis.

Biological Tissue Dehydrator Market- Market Dynamics

Increasing demand for histopathology testing and from pathology laboratories, diagnostic centers are expected to propel market demand

The biological tissue dehydrator market is mainly driven by the rising demand for histopathology testing and accurate disease diagnosis across the globe. With the increasing incidence of cancer, chronic diseases and infectious disorders, healthcare providers are conducting more tissue biopsy procedures to facilitate early detection and treatment planning. The growing diagnostic workload is generating a high demand for efficient and reliable tissue dehydration systems to provide high quality specimen preparation. According to the World Health Organization (WHO), around 20 million new cancer cases were found globally in 2024, weighing the growing need for pathology services and tissue processing technologies. Accurate tissue processing is a critical step in histopathology, as the quality of dehydrated tissue directly influences microscopic examination and diagnostic accuracy. To improve laboratory efficiency and ensure consistent results, hospitals, diagnostic laboratories, and research institutions are increasingly using tissue dehydrators.

Another important factor supporting market growth is the continuous expansion of pathology laboratories, diagnostic centers, and specialized testing facilities worldwide. As healthcare systems focus on timely and accurate diagnosis, laboratories are experiencing growing pressure to process larger numbers of specimens while maintaining high quality standards. To address these challenges, many laboratories are investing in automated tissue dehydrators that streamline tissue processing workflows and minimize dependence on manual procedures. These systems help improve operational efficiency, reduce processing variability, and ensure consistent sample preparation across large testing volumes. Thus, with the number of pathology tests continues to rise globally, the need for reliable, high-performance tissue processing solutions is expected to grow, making automated tissue dehydrators an essential component in diagnosis.

Biological Tissue Dehydrator Market- Segmentation Analysis:

The Global Biological Tissue Dehydrator Market is segmented on the basis of Type, Capacity, Application, End-Use, and Region.

The market is divided into three categories based on Type: automatic tissue dehydrators, semi-automatic tissue dehydrators, and manual tissue dehydrators. Automatic tissue dehydrator segment accounted for a substantial share in the market. Automatic tissue dehydrators hold the largest share of the market owing to their ability to streamline tissue processing, minimize manual handling, and deliver highly consistent results. These systems are widely preferred by hospitals and pathology laboratories as they can deliver large volume processing.

Saudi Arabia Biological Tissue Dehydrator Market- Key Insights

Saudi Arabia's continuous investments in healthcare infrastructure, diagnostic services, and medical technology modernization are making the country a significant market for biological tissue dehydrators. The Saudi Arabian government is developing healthcare facilities, bolstering laboratory networks, and enhancing access to specialized diagnostic services as part of the national healthcare transformation programs linked with Vision 2030. The need for sophisticated histology and tissue processing technology in hospitals and diagnostic facilities is rising as a result of these initiatives. The adoption of contemporary histology equipment is being aided by the growth of private healthcare providers as well as the creation of cutting-edge medical towns and specialized treatment facilities.
